The Burning Question – Will Robin van Persie Be “Essential” Once Again?

It’s time for the third instalment in our Burning Questions series, focussing on some of the main dilemmas facing Fantasy managers for the season ahead. Having quizzed our contributors on Alexis Sanchez’ prospects and Defensive Heavy Hitters, we now turn our attentions on a certain Dutch forward, as United prepare for their first season under new boss Louis van Gaal.

When Van Gaal’s appointment was first announced, our expectations for Robin van Persie soared. The veteran manager’s preferred 4-3-3 formation looked set to force Wayne Rooney and Juan Mata onto the flanks and hand his compatriot the lone forward role but, since taking the helm, Van Gaal has continued with the 3-4-1-2 formation that earned Holland third place at the recent World Cup.

Rooney and Mata have resultantly flourished in central roles for the Red Devils over the summer friendlies so far and, whilst Van Persie has yet to return to action after his summer exploits in Brazil 2014, the former pair approach the upcoming campaign in excellent form.

At 12.5 in Fantasy Premier League (FPL), Van Persie is the priciest option available to Fantasy managers despite scoring just 12 times in an injury-hit campaign under David Moyes last time around. Granted, with Van Gaal at the helm, we can surely expect an improvement but can he rediscover the form that served up 56 goals, 28 assists and 94 bonus points over 2011/12 and 2012/13?

With just a week to go until their season opener at home to Swansea, we ask the question – Can Robin Van Persie emerge as “essential” once again?

Applebonkers says…
Back in May 2010 a man called Darren in a Sunderland shirt took me to one side and said, “Son, look at me, I’ve scored 24 goals this season and played in all 38 matches. Yet I still haven’t reached the 200 point mark.” It was at this point that I learnt that it is not actually the more alluring goal which makes the true heavyweight striker, but the assist.

So I think this question could be as simple as will Van Persie start to pump out the assists again? We know he’ll score goals as not even David Moyes could unpolish that diamond, it’s all about the three point cousin. Fellow left-footer Juan Mata is a serious contender for right-sided set-pieces and that could dent van Persie’s potential to earn assists from the deadball.

The Dutchman’s number of passes and all-round involvement plummeted last season, this not only hurts his assist threat but hit him hard on bonus too. Rooney’s 46 passes per game compared to van Persie’s 18 (30 being the magic mark) meant the Dutchman struggled to compete with Rooney’s goals. Overall I’m sceptical whether van Gaal will help inject enough mojo back in to replicate the essential version of 2011 and 2012.

7shadesofsmoke says…
Was Robin van Persie (RvP) ever essential? The age-old argument goes that RvP is the Fantasy manager’s comfort blanket, the easy choice for captaincy if you want guaranteed returns, but in his most productive season (2011/12) his 269 points came at a rate of 12.38 minutes per point (MPP). He was slightly quicker again in 2012/13 but had fewer minutes, registering 262 points at a rate of 11.91 MPP – slower than Theo Walcott in the same season, let’s not forget.

Considering his eternally mighty price tag, I did present a case for a non RvP captaincy strategy before the start of last season and I’d adopt the same stance again this year. Will Van Persie be a major factor again? I really do think so. Luis van Gaal will need his main man back at his best if he is to make United a force to be reckoned with once more, but is RvP worth the extra 2.0 over his inevitable strike partner, Wayne Rooney? That’s far less clear.

If Robin van Comfort Blanket registered a point every 12.49 minutes over the past three years – in two of which he won the Premier League Golden Boot -Wayne Rooney offers up a similarly consistent point every 12.94 minutes for considerably less over the same period. It would take a season of Luis Suarez proportions for the Dutchman to be tagged ‘essential’ in my plans.

Swanny14 says…
As a Man United fan, please excuse any excessive bias here. But yes, I don’t believe that RVP’s ‘essential’ days are behind him. In an underperforming side and with a whopping 14.0 price tag hanging heavily around his neck last season, many of us naturally fell out of love with the Dutchman as our ‘affections’ turned towards Luis Suarez. But Old Trafford is a very different place now. With Louis van Gaal at the helm, a certain spark seems to have returned to the United side (just watch some of the football they’ve been playing in pre-season, the link-up play is miles ahead of anything we saw from them last year) and Van Persie is certain to benefit from his close relationship with his former international coach.

Sure the Dutchman wasn’t in the finest of form in 2013/14, but Van Persie still bagged 16 goals in 27 appearances in all competitions, and that’s with a midfield behind him that had about as much creativity as a sofa. If Van Gaal can get new signing Ander Herrera pulling the strings in the middle of the park, and figure out the ‘RVP, Rooney, Mata’ dilemma as David Moyes failed to do, then Van Persie – bar injuries – will have the platform to return to his title-winning heroics of 2012/13 and acquire his ‘essential’ status once again in the coming season.

    Seen some very helpful posts from fans of clubs giving short summaries of the state of the clubs they support so I thought I'd give a crack at the club I support, Crystal Palace.

    GK: Much as been made of whether or not Speroni will start ahead of Hennessey and there have been recent quotes by Parish saying that Speroni will not be guaranteed anything. Hennessey was bought with an eye towards the future as Speroni is certainly getting up there in age but Speroni has done nothing wrong to lose his place. TP has been splitting their minutes this preseason so far, though, so there is certainly some cause for concern either way as to who will start. I have a hunch Speroni will start at the Emirates but I would be surprised if he starts all year long. Either way, I would not back him from the off with these question marks.

    DEF: Ward is nailed, arguably the teams best player, and an excellent route into the defense. Dann is nailed as well, and also a reliable way into the defense. The one thing that Ward does have in favor, as they are both priced at 5.0, is the ability to play occasionally OOP as a CDM where he has acquitted himself quite well and has got some short bursts this preseason in America at that position. Hangeland's signing puts some doubt over Delaney's current status, and he played over him in today's friendly but it was because Delaney had a knock. Either way, neither of these two should be considered over Ward or Dann as they are all priced at 5.0.

    The LB position is the one that has been most in question and while Mariappa was an early favorite on here it is pretty clear that TP does not trust him at all to handle the LB duties. Jerome Williams has been getting a lot of playing time and looks to have the leg up, but is of course not yet added as the FPL towers continue to twiddle their thumbs. The simple fact of the matter is Palace needs to buy a LB as Mariappa is not good enough and Williams is too young and not yet ready. I am completely stunned that TP has not bought someone yet, and fully expect him to do so before the transfer window closes, however they have been eerily quiet with transfer rumors at this position. Even if Jerome Williams was added at 4.5 I would not feel comfortable getting him as I would not want to spend an early transfer on a defender as well as with Ward and Dann nailed at only .5 more.

    MID: After the failed attempt at trying to sign Gylfi, who would have fit perfectly in the hole for Palace, the only real fantasy prospect on the team is Puncheon and he has been chugging along this preseason. He is the type of player who you want to own for only a short time when he is on form and that remains to be seen to start off so it may be best to wait until his purple patch seems to be coming and then hop on board.

    Joe Ledley, at 5.5, is someone who never gets talked about on here but may yet surprise some people this year as he is poised to take on the no.10 role. He played pretty well for Palace last season after he was transferred in and unless someone with more creativity there is no one really in the squad to threaten his place after the loss of Ince. Although Palace do not score a ton of goals, if they get a kind run of fixtures, he could be someone to keep an eye on as a cheap midfield option. However, this is another area that Palace have been trying to improve upon and may yet still sign someone before this transfer window closes.

    FWD: All Palace forwards are priced at 5.5 and it looks like Frazier Campbell and Chamakh should get the nod up front for GW1. Campbell is a prototypical TP forward and Chamakh has really been a favorite of TP since he came in with his improved work rate. Gayle looks like he will be used as an impact sub which should suit him. Glenn Murray's place in the squad is in question as we recently rejected a bid in order to keep him - it looks like he will be kept to provide depth. If Chamakh is able to improve his finishing a bit this year he could be worth a shout as he does seem to get into pretty decent scoring positions, but there doesn't seem to be much value in the Palace forwards this year as they just don't score a whole lot.
